Transaction 07abf239bf71e5c3f84c3f1e571fe7df169adbe474d78f1606b19c4a84e7fe71

3 Input
2 Outputs
  • 07abf239bf71e5c3f84c3f1e571fe7df169adbe474d78f1606b19c4a84e7fe71:0
  • value  10239
    address  17UhmPyzQaADEU3zG9f3WTHZbQSLWVHY4L
  • 07abf239bf71e5c3f84c3f1e571fe7df169adbe474d78f1606b19c4a84e7fe71:1
  • value  1256000
    address  3DUAtYwsraoiAPBaB3CTG6CVq6y1Rd8amG